Kenya Airways need not take over JKIA operations to survive

KQ003 Flight that landed at JKIA Nairobi from New York City. [FILE PHOTO:WILBERFORCE OKWIRI]

Kenyans should be excused for harbouring the inaccurate and false impression that Kenya Airways (KQ) has suddenly found itself in a financial dementia whose only prescription for resuscitation is taking over the operations of Jomo Kenyatta International Airport (JKIA) from the Kenya Airports Authority (KAA).

What is being fed to the unsuspecting public by the proponents of the JKIA take-over by KQ is absolute lies.
